After the change that the NVMe bdev module disconnects qpair asynchronously,
disconnected_qpair_cb() got NOTICELOG always when a qpair was disconnected
and freed. This was very noisy.
We have three cases that disconnected_qpair_cb() is called now, 1) qpair
was destroyed in a full ctrlr reset sequence, 2) the upper layer closed
I/O channel, and 3) qpair detected error, and was disconnected and freed.
Get NOTICELOG for 3) but get DEBUGLOG for 1) and 2) with some rewording.
Additionally, to improve readability, change if-else ordering.
